What did I thought about the quality of design and construction of this sclashy headphone
I tested the black version of Skullcandy Crusher Anc 2, and it is as low and smooth as it gets. The orange power button is a good off-beat touch that adds a pop of personality to the otherwise understood design. Padded headbands and ear cups feel comfortable first, and they are easily adjustable to fit the size of the head most. The build quality bends towards durability rather than luxury, which is expected at this price point.
He said, after wearing them 4-5 hours directly, I saw some inconvenience – the clamping force started hurting my ears, and the weight of the headphone became noticeable. If you are planning to use them for an extended period, it may be something to consider. Nevertheless, for small bursts of use, they are completely fine.
Sound Quality: Does Bass Show Steal
Let’s talk about the star of the show – Bass. Along with maximizing the bass slider, the tone of the Kendrick Lamar felt as if they were being directly given to my soul. It is immersive, porous and perfect for styles such as hip-hop, EDM and rock. On the other hand, turning the slider down all the way causes almost no bass, which fulfills the listeners who prefer a flattery sound profile. This level of adaptation is a large plus.
However, mids and higher do not keep enough. While the bass dominates, vowels and equipment sometimes feel drowning, especially on high versions. For example, when I heard acoustic tracks, the lack of clarity in the mids made the experience less enjoyable. These headphones are clearly designed for bass lovers, so if you are looking for a balanced audio, they may not be your best condition.
How does the noise cancellation of Skaklandy Crusher ANC 2
Active noise cancellation (ANC) Effectively reduces low-frequency sounds like airplane’s engine or traffic hums. During my traffic, I saw a significant decline in the background noise, making it easy to enjoy my music. However, loud sounds or suddenly like claters seem to have been successful in leaking. Without ANC, inactive noise isolation is decent, thanks to the snug fit of the ear cup.
Being functional for most conditions, ANC does not compete with a premium model such as Bose or Sony. If you are in a noisy environment, it will help – but not expected of complete silence.

Which battery life you should expect from these scalkandy headphones
Battery life crusher is one of the strongest points of ANC2. With ANC competent, it provides playback up to 40 hours, which is more than enough for the days of use without recharging. I used them during a weekend trip, and they walked throughout the time without the need for a recharge. The rapid charging feature is also a lifeline – if you forget to charge them, the 10 -minute charge gives you a 4 -hour playback. It was useful when I was coming out of the door one morning.
Connectivity: Stable and versatile
The headphones support Bluetooth multipoint, allowing you to connect with two devices simultaneously. I tested it by pairing them with my laptop for work calls and my phone for music. It was easy to switch between the two, and the connection remained stable within the 33-foot range. Topical dropouts occur in areas with heavy intervention, but overall, connectivity is reliable.
Skulliq App: Customization for Tech-Service Listener
The Skullcandy Skulliq app adds an additional layer of functionality for users who want more control over their audio experience. Through the app, you can accommodate EQ settings to fix the sound profile according to your preferences. For example, I slightly increased the mids to balance the overpowering bass during acoustic tracks, causing noticeable difference.
The app also allows you to toggle features such as tile tracking and check the battery status of both headphones and charging cases. While casual listeners cannot dive deeply in these settings, audiofiles will appreciate specific styles or the ability to conform the sound to suit individual taste. However, the app interface seems a bit basic than contestants such as Sony’s headphone connect app, which provides a more advanced adaptation option.
For those who know what they are doing, the Skulliq app is a useful tool-but it is not a game-changer if you are just looking for plug-end-play simplicity.

Last word:
Skullcandy Crusher ANC 2 is a practical option for users who prefer bass, battery life and strength. It is not a top level headphone in terms of sound balance or noise cancellation, but it provides solid performance for casual listeners. If you enjoy bass-heavy music and want a reliable pair of headphones for everyday use, then crusher ANC2 is considering.
However, if you are looking for a more sophisticated sound profile or industry-agron ANC, find out high-end options such as Bose or Sony.
